When Stephen spoke, he gave his accusers the gospel--in the context of history. He started with father Abraham. In Genesis, Abraham's faith is characterized by obedience to God's word and belief in God's promises. He believed that his descendants would possess the promised land, even though he owned no land and had no children. He accepted God's plan to train his descendants in Egypt for 400 years, and sealed God's covenant with circumcision.

Because of their jealousy, the patriarchs (Joseph's brothers) sold Joseph as a slave into Egypt. But God was with Joseph. He gave him wisdom and turned his adversity into victory. Through Joseph, God accomplished the first part of his plan, and brought Abraham's descendants to Egypt, so that they might grow into a great multitude. During that time, they held on to God's promise to give them the land though they suffered as slaves (16).

Do you find it hard to see what God is doing? Like Abraham and Joseph, we must trust in his promises, live by faith, and believe he will bless those who obey him (Ge 12:2,3).
